liquids. For over 30 years, electrostatic separation has
evolved to be a robust, proven, automatic process to remove
FCC catalyst fines from slurry oil or other hydrocarbon
streams. Unaffected by the presence of asphaltenes,
electrostatic separation can be used to remove solids not
only from resid FCC derived slurry oil but also from gas oil
crackers. Operating at 160°C – 220°C, electrostatic separators
use depolarised glass beads to departiculate fines from the
product stream. The fluidised glass bead allows for a low
pressure drop and is not susceptible to blockage from
asphaltenes or waxes. Even the presence of antimony does
not cause issues within the system.

Economics
Recently, a Middle Eastern refinery installed an electrostatic
separator to replace a failed mechanical filtration unit. The
refinery conducted an economic study to evaluate the impact
of the change in separation and filtration technologies. Several
advantages became evident once the electrostatic separator
unit was put on line, including the following:
The increased quality of clarified slurry oil and proper
fines removal provided a fast return on investment (ROI),
offering increased profit realisation within months.
The use of raw FCC/RFCC feed enabled the refinery to
realise all the LCO and heavy cycle oil (HCO) for
